Abstract
Perioperative nurses are called upon to use their power of ethical analysis to decrease a patient's vulnerability and to benefit the patients under their care. Through a practice-based approach that focuses on individual patients within their actual context, the possibility of bringing this about, with the best possible outcome, increases. This approach also enhances a nurse's feeling of self-worth and pride.
